Maine Increases Training Requirements for Reserves
Reserve officers will have to complete a 40-hour online course, meet a physical fitness requirement, then take 80 hours of practical instruction, before serving under a field training officer for another 80 hours.

Arrests by Reserve Officer Cause Turmoil in Albuquerque
The Albuquerque Police Department has suspended its reserve program and identified 46 other criminal cases that reserve officers handled, ranging from traffic tickets to domestic violence. Those cases may end up challenged in court.
